Opinicus Capital Inc. reduced its holdings in shares of i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F (NYSEARCA:IJH – Free Report) by 2.1% in the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The fund owned 35,950 shares of the company’s stock after selling 788 shares during the quarter. i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F comprises approximately 1.9% of Opinicus Capital Inc.’s holdings, making the stock its 13th biggest position. Opinicus Capital Inc.’s holdings in i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F were worth $2,240,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F
Ishares S&P Midcap 400 Index Fund, formerly The i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F (the Fund), seeks investment results that correspond to the price and yield performance, before fees and expenses, of the United States mid-cap stocks, as represented by the Standard & Poor’s MidCap 400 (the Underlying Index).
